International Battery Metals Narrows Operating Loss to $2.9 Million in First Quarter

By Mining Hub News Desk
13 August 2026, 9:41 a.m. EDT 2 min read

International Battery Metals reported a first-quarter net loss of $28 thousand, or $0.00 per share, for the period ended June 30, 2026, shifting from a net income of $1.7 million, or $0.01 per share, in the same period of fiscal 2026.

Revenue for the quarter rose to $120 thousand compared to $7 thousand in the prior-year period, reflecting service revenue generated from ongoing brine testing activities. Operating costs, excluding depreciation, fell to $0.4 million from $0.6 million, while selling, general and administrative expenses decreased to $1.8 million from $2.3 million.

These expense reductions helped narrow the operating loss for the quarter to $2.9 million, compared with an operating loss of $3.6 million in the first quarter of fiscal 2026. The company also recorded a $2.9 million gain from the change in fair value of its warrant liability, down from a $5.3 million gain a year earlier. Cash stood at $9.4 million as of June 30, 2026, up slightly from $9.2 million at the end of March.

The financial update follows leadership changes at the advanced technology provider, with Garrett Galloway stepping in as Interim Chief Executive Officer. International Battery Metals uses proprietary extraction media housed in patented extraction columns within modular, transportable skid-mounted platforms to extract lithium from brine.

“My focus is the next step, taking that work and putting our technology into the field. I've been leading the counterparty conversations for the past year, so this transition doesn't change where we're headed or how we get there. The technical and operational teams have not changed and are ready for execution. We're actively pursuing opportunities in the Smackover, the Middle East and Argentina. The market remains supportive, and resource owners are engaging more in evaluating potential projects and DLE.”

— Garrett Galloway, Interim Chief Executive Officer
